Transaction 83d144129a30c673f62fed04ce131f001a5548c2d7d8e02b718e7e1dc177b5ce
1 Input
1 Output
-
83d144129a30c673f62fed04ce131f001a5548c2d7d8e02b718e7e1dc177b5ce:0
- value
- 300516123
- script pubkey
- OP_0 OP_PUSHBYTES_20 3098da02c14f205b4e1905c5fb9939f3f619ae7a
- address
- bc1qxzvd5qkpfus9knseqhzlhxfe70mpntn68nngn3